Roger Vaught joins IMARK Canada

January 26, 2015 | By Renée Francoeur



January 26, 2015 – Roger Vaught has been appointed to the position of vice-president of member development with IMARK Canada, announced the company earlier this month.

Vaught has been involved with the North American electrical industry for over 30 years and specifically in the Canadian electrical market since 1990, working with several electrical manufacturers including Thomas & Betts and Columbia/MBF (Atkore), said IMARK.

For the last 11 years, he held various positions with Atkore International; his last being vice-president of North America electrical sales.   
 
In his new role, Vaught will focus primarily on the recruitment of new members to IMARK Canada as well as acting as a resource for current members. He will report directly to Jerry Knight of IMARK.
